Located in the heart of London at 252 High Holborn, within the elegant Rosewood Hotel, the Mirror Room Menu offers a refined and immersive dining experience that reflects both contemporary culinary craftsmanship and luxurious ambiance. As someone who appreciates elevated gastronomy, I found the Mirror Room to be an exquisite destination for those seeking sophistication in both service and flavour.

The menu is an artful composition of modern European cuisine with seasonal British influences. Signature dishes such as the Dorset crab salad or the beef tartare with smoked egg yolk showcase the kitchen’s precision and dedication to sourcing premium local ingredients. The afternoon tea selection, a highlight in itself, blends traditional and contemporary elements, with patisserie creations inspired by British heritage and fashion.

One feature that distinguishes the Mirror Room from other upscale dining venues is its visual presentation - not just of the food but of the room itself. Surrounded by mirrored panels, crystal chandeliers, and plush seating, the ambiance enhances every bite. The menu, too, is curated to match this visual opulence: delicate yet bold, balanced yet inventive.

Service here is attentive without being intrusive - staff are well-versed in the intricacies of the dishes and provide thoughtful wine pairings to complement each course. Whether you’re indulging in a leisurely lunch or a celebratory dinner, the dining experience feels polished and memorable.

Compared to other fine-dining spots in Central London, the Mirror Room stands out for its fusion of haute cuisine and artistic presentation. While pricing is on the higher end, the overall experience justifies the cost, especially for special occasions or those eager to explore a menu rooted in modern elegance.

For anyone in search of a luxurious culinary experience in London, the Mirror Room Menu is well worth exploring.
